xProduct Details
Memory Type | Volatile | Memory Format | SRAM |
---|---|---|---|
Technology | SRAM - Synchronous, SDR | Memory Size | 36Mbit |
Memory Organization | 512K X 72 | Memory Interface | Parallel |
Clock Frequency | 167 MHz | Write Cycle Time - Word, Page | - |
Access Time | 3.4 Ns | Voltage - Supply | 3.135V ~ 3.6V |
Operating Temperature | -40°C ~ 85°C (TA) | Mounting Type | Surface Mount |
Package / Case | 209-BGA | Supplier Device Package | 209-FBGA (14x22) |

Functional Description
The CY7C1460AV33/CY7C1462AV33/CY7C1464AV33 are 3.3V, 1M x 36/2M x 18/512K x72 Synchronous pipelined burst SRAMs with No Bus Latency™ (NoBL™) logic, respectively. They are designed to support unlimited true back-to-back Read/Write operations with no wait states. The CY7C1460AV33/CY7C1462AV33/CY7C1464AV33 are equipped with the advanced (NoBL) logic required to enable consecutive Read/Write operations with data being transferred on every clock cycle. This feature dramatically improves the throughput of data in systems that require frequent Write/Read transitions. The CY7C1460AV33/CY7C1462AV33/CY7C1464AV33 are pin compatible and functionally equivalent to ZBT devices.
Features
• Pin-compatible and functionally equivalent to ZBT™• Supports 250-MHz bus operations with zero wait states
— Available speed grades are 250, 200 and 167 MHz
• Internally self-timed output buffer control to eliminate the need to use asynchronous OE
• Fully registered (inputs and outputs) for pipelined operation
• Byte Write capability
• 3.3V power supply
• 3.3V/2.5V I/O power supply
• Fast clock-to-output times
— 2.6 ns (for 250-MHz device)
• Clock Enable (CEN) pin to suspend operation
• Synchronous self-timed writes
• CY7C1460AV33, CY7C1462AV33 available in
JEDEC-standard lead-free 100-pin TQFP, lead-free and
non-lead-free 165-ball FBGA package. CY7C1464AV33
available in lead-free and non-lead-free 209-ball FBGA
package
• IEEE 1149.1 JTAG-Compatible Boundary Scan
• Burst capability—linear or interleaved burst order
• “ZZ” Sleep Mode option and Stop Clock option
